How to develop good interpersonal skills and social skills?

How to develop good interpersonal skills and social skills for a person who is not kind of very extrovert.

self-disclosure (by sharing information, we become more intimate with other people and our interpersonal relationship is strengthened) is the key to communications.

you need to become more comfortable with yourself….even on a small scale and your communication and interpersonal skills will improve.

    Volunteer Work! Go out and volunteer anyplace that is in need of people. You will learn new skills without the pressure of "being fired" you will meet new people/friends which will boost your self confidence level, and you will feel better about yourself because you are helping someone else out. It also looks good on a resume and adds experiences and skills.
